# Components:
→ Green Tea
01 - 2 green tea bags
02 - 2 cups hot water (about 175°F)
→ Peach Syrup
03 - 1 cup peach nectar or peach juice
04 - 2 tablespoons simple syrup (or 2 tablespoons honey/agave as an alternative)
→ Lemonade
05 - 1 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ice (about 4 lemons)
06 - 1/2 cup cold water
07 - 1/4 cup granulated sugar (adjust to taste)
→ To Serve
08 - Ice cubes
09 - Fresh peach slices (optional)
10 - Mint leaves (optional)
# Method:
01 - Pour 2 cups of hot water (about 175°F) over the 2 green tea bags in a heatproof vessel. Steep 2–3 minutes, remove the bags, then transfer the tea to the refrigerator or set aside to cool to room temperature.
02 - In a pitcher, combine 1 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ice, 1/2 cup cold water and 1/4 cup granulated sugar. Stir until the sugar dissolves completely.
03 - In a small bowl or measuring cup, whisk together 1 cup peach nectar and 2 tablespoons simple syrup (or honey/agave). Taste and adjust sweetness as needed.
04 - Fill serving glasses with ice. Pour equal parts cooled green tea, peach syrup and lemonade into each glass (approximately one part of each per glass). Stir gently to combine.
05 - Top each glass with peach slices and mint leaves if desired. Serve immediately and advise guests to stir before drinking.
